The most frequent cause for a localized "down" status is a regional domain block. Due to the nature of public file-hosting, these platforms often host unverified or copyrighted material. For example, courts in regions like Europe have previously issued blocking orders targeting file-hosters like Nippyspace to restrict local ISP access.
